CompanionAI

CompanionAI is a prototype AI system designed to provide friendly companionship, adaptive support, and practical assistance. The project is built with Flask to showcase its features through a simple web application.


Key Features

  • Fully on-device inference — no cloud dependency, no data exfiltration
  • RAG-based long-term memory — personalized knowledge base built from caregiver-provided biography and dynamically updated from conversations
  • Short-term memory (STM) — rolling conversation summarization for coherent multi-turn dialogue
  • Proactive conversation management — LLM-based intent routing and personalized topic pool
  • Event management — natural language scheduling with recurring event support
  • Speech I/O — speech-to-text (STT) input and text-to-speech (TTS) output for accessibility
  • Caregiver dashboard — password-protected interface for biography management, event entry, and conversation monitoring

Functionalities

1. Friendly Companionship: Engage in warm, reassuring conversations that make you feel supported and less alone. The system is designed to respond naturally and provide a comforting presence.

2. Smart Adaptation: CompanionAI continuously learns from your interactions, adjusting to your habits, preferences, and emotional needs. Over time, it becomes more personalized and aligned with your lifestyle.

3. Event & Reminder Tracking: Stay on top of your daily life. CompanionAI remembers important events, medications, and appointments, sending reminders so you never miss what matters.

4. Family Access Dashboard: Relatives and caregivers can securely access a dedicated dashboard (example password: 1234). From there, they can add personal details, schedule reminders, and review chat history to stay updated on the user’s wellbeing.

5. Works Completely Offline: All features are available without internet. No cloud services are involved — your data remains on your device only.

6. Guaranteed Privacy: Privacy is at the core of CompanionAI. Nothing is transmitted or shared; your conversations and personal information stay fully private.

Getting Started

1. Clone the Repository

git clone https://github.com/andreabochicchio02/CompanionAI.git
cd CompanionAI

2. Set Up Python Environment

Using a Conda environment with Python 3.11 is recommended:

conda create -n companionai python=3.11
conda activate companionai

3. Install Dependencies

Install all required packages from requirements.txt:

pip install -r requirements.txt

4. Install and Configure Ollama

This project relies on Ollama to run local LLMs. Make sure it is installed and then download the models:

ollama pull llama3.2:3b
ollama pull gemma3:1b

5. Run the Application

Start Ollama, then launch the web app:

python app.py

6. Access the Web Application

Once running, open: http://127.0.0.1:5000

You will find:

  • User Page: chat directly with CompanionAI.
  • Family Dashboard: access with password 1234 to add events, manage reminders, and view chat history.

Notes

  • The dashboard password is hardcoded as 1234 for demonstration only.
  • All information is stored locally. Deleting the project folder will erase your data.
